AASHTO MP 36

Standard Specification for Materials for Asphalt Tack Coat

active, Most Current
Buy Now
Organization: AASHTO
Publication Date: 1 January 2018
Status: active
Page Count: 3
scope:

This standard specifies quality requirements for emulsified asphalt or performance-graded asphalt binder for tack coats.

A tack coat is the application of an emulsified asphalt or performance-graded (PG) asphalt binder, to an existing pavement surface just prior to placement of a pavement overlay course. The tack coat is used to ensure a good bond between an existing asphalt or concrete pavement and a pavement overlay course, between multiple pavement lifts of a structural pavement, and at any vertical surfaces to which a new pavement layer will be placed adjacent, such as curbs, gutters, utilities, and construction joints.
